Notes from Tuesday's returns call. Nine demo units of the Corvell tablet line are coming back from the Fenwick showroom, boxed and inventory-tagged. Receiving should check screens for burn-in and log condition on arrival. Expected delivery window is Wednesday afternoon. At hand-over, the courier is to be given the instruction below.

dispatch memo: the eliok quenok courier leaves the sorael aldath belion tammir casix gileth queniel jorath ledger at gate 9299 under passcode 897989

## Offline Mode Builds — Terravue Survey App

Welcome aboard! Terravue's offline mode ships as a separate build flavor so field crews in the Dunmoor region can sync later. Every offline build comes from the Hatchline pipeline with a signed provenance record — never sideload anything unsigned. If a device acts weird, check its build against the registry first. The current build's token is below.

session token of tajef-bageg = htk21_5d90d574934f3ccae6437

Step 3: Publish the Fabrikoot test-data factory library to the internal registry. Version 2.4 removes the legacy seeding shim, so downstream teams must bump their lockfiles. The publish job runs from the release runner and needs registry write access, so append the credential to the runner's .env file on the line below.

vault entry, yahif-yajep: COURIER_KEY29=b802bdf8034096b65a51c6ba5abe2